PC Downloads
For PC gamers, the most popular platforms for downloading MMOs include Steam, the Epic Games Store, and GOG. Here’s how to download MMOs from these stores:
Steam
To download an MMO from Steam, follow these steps:
- Visit the Steam Store.
- Search for the MMO you wish to download.
- Select the game and click on Add to Cart.
- Proceed to checkout and complete your purchase.
- Once purchased, the game will be added to your library. Click Install to begin the download.
Epic Games Store
To download an MMO from the Epic Games Store, follow these steps:
- Access the Epic Games Store.
- Use the search bar to find your desired MMO.
- Click on the game to open its page and select Get.
- Follow the prompts to complete your purchase.
- Open your library and click Install to start downloading the game.
GOG
For MMOs available on GOG, here's how you can download:
- Go to the GOG website.
- Search for the MMO you want to download.
- Click on Add to Cart and proceed to checkout.
- Once you've purchased the game, go to your library.
- Click Download to initiate the installation process.

System Requirements
Before downloading any MMO, it's crucial to check the system requirements to ensure your device can handle the game. Most MMOs will list their minimum and recommended specifications on the download page. Here’s a general overview:
Typical Requirements for PC Games
- OS: Windows 10 (64-bit)
- Processor: Intel Core i3 or equivalent
- Memory: 8 GB RAM
- Graphics: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 660 or equivalent
- DirectX: Version 11
- Storage: At least 20 GB free space
Typical Requirements for Console Games
- Console: PlayStation 4/5, Xbox One/Series X, or Nintendo Switch
- Internet Connection: Broadband internet for online gameplay
